Overview

PC Support Center is a software program developed by PC Support Center. During setup, the program creates a startup registration point in Windows in order to automatically start when any user boots the PC. The primary executable is named callcenter.exe. The setup package generally installs about 11 files and is usually about 5.5 MB (5,762,012 bytes). Relative to the overall usage of those who have this installed, most are running it on Windows 10. Most users that have installed this software come from the United States.

How do I remove PC Support Center?

You can uninstall PC Support Center from your computer by using the Add/Remove Program feature in the Window's Control Panel.
  1. On the Start menu (for Windows 8, right-click the screen's bottom-left corner), click Control Panel, and then, under Programs, do one of the following:
    • Windows Vista/7/8/10: Click Uninstall a Program.
    • Windows XP: Click Add or Remove Programs.
  2. When you find the program PC Support Center, click it, and then do one of the following:
    • Windows Vista/7/8/10: Click Uninstall.
    • Windows XP: Click the Remove or Change/Remove tab (to the right of the program).
  3. Follow the prompts. A progress bar shows you how long it will take to remove PC Support Center.
